Wedding Cake
A wedding cake is the traditional cake served to the guests at a wedding breakfast, after a wedding. It is usually a large cake, multi-layered or tiered, and heavily decorated, often with icing over a layer of marzipan, topped with a small statue of a bride and groom. Other common motifs include doves, gold rings and horseshoes, the latter symbolizing good luck. ...
The traditional fruit cake is still the most popular.
The significance of the wedding cake has been loaded with symbolism - whether the bride and groom's first cut represents fertility, the first meal of a married couple or the beginning of a shared life - or simply the end of the wedding reception. Symbolizing faithfulness and sharing it is traditional for the couple to share the cutting of the first slice of the Wedding Cake. The wedding cake should be cut just before dessert at a luncheon or dinner reception, just after the guests have been received at a tea or cocktail reception.
